Dorothy Rodham, 92, a suburban Chicago homemaker who endured a devastating childhood and served as an inspiration to her daughter, Hillary Rodham Clinton, one of the most accomplished women in American government, died Nov. 1 at a hospital in Washington. Mrs. Rodham spent decades as a familiar but unflashy presence alongside her daughter, Secretary of State Hillary Rodham Clinton, and son-in-law, former President Bill Clinton. Read full article > >

Facebook names political veteran Erskine Bowles to board

Wednesday, September 7th, 2011

Facebook on Wednesday named political veteran Erskine Bowles to its board of directors, saying the former chief of staff for President Bill Clinton will lend his expertise as the firm plans further global expansion. With its growth — and the accumulation of more than 750 million active users — Facebook has encountered a slew of political and policy battles. It is grappling with different government rules on online privacy , government censorship, copyright and intellectual property protection, Internet safety and Internet access restrictions. Former secretary of state Warren Christopher dies at 85

Saturday, March 19th, 2011

Warren M. Christopher, a Democratic Party mandarin who led the State Department during President Bill Clinton’s first term and found himself confronted by an array of foreign policy crises, most profoundly the ethnic slaughter in the Balkans and Rwanda, died Friday night in Los Angeles of complications from kidney and bladder cancer, the Associated Press reported. He was 85.
